We&#8217;ve called him cool, and we truly believed it. But that coolness has failed to show itself in Test  cricket. Everybody pardoned Dhoni&#8217;s less than stellar performance against Pakistan. Too early, we echoed. But nothing has changed in Australia so far. Just 105 runs in 6 innings. Sehwag came into his own. Pathan bounced back (Interesting, he always gets Man of the Match on bouncing back), but Dhoni has kept everyone waiting. Karthik for Adelaide, anyone?
